  • Abstract
    A watermarking scheme for JPEG image authentication is proposed. It is a direct extension of Wong´s algorithm to JPEG-coded images where the signature is embedded at the end of scanned DCT coefficients. instead of LSB´s of raw pixel values. We address a problem that the watermark disappears after the integer rounding in JPEG decompression and show that imposing a restriction on the quantization step sizes for DCT coefficients can solve this problem. To avoid the limitation on compressed picture quality set by this restriction, we introduce an embedding technique to use different quantization vectors for the watermarking and the JPEG compression. Simulation results are shown to verify the proposed scheme.
